Poogal
Poogal is a village located in Poogal tehsil of Bikaner district in Rajasthan, India. It is situated 82km away from district headquarter Poogal. Poogal is the sub-district headquarter of Poogal village. As per 2009 stats, Pugal is the gram panchayat of Poogal village.

About Poogal
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Poogal is 069172. The village spans a total geographical area of 14044 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 334808. Bikaner is nearest town to Poogal village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 82km away.
When it comes to local governance, Poogal village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Khajuwala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Bikaner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Poogal
Below is a concise population overview of Poogal as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 5,833 | 3,068 | 2,765 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 990 | 527 | 463 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 1,089 | 559 | 530 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 17 | 7 | 10 |
Literate Population | 2,790 | 1,774 | 1,016 |
Illiterate Population | 3,043 | 1,294 | 1,749 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Poogal village:
- The total population of Poogal village is around 5,833, including approximately 3,068 males and 2,765 females, with a sex ratio of 901 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 990 children aged 0–6 years in Poogal village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Poogal village has 1,089 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 17 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Poogal village is about 47.83%, with male literacy at 57.82% and female literacy at 36.75%.
- There are around 1,090 households in Poogal village.
Connectivity of Poogal
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Poogal. As per the 2011 stats, Poogal had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
